Hello doctor. I have a 2 month old baby girl. Past few weeks, she feeds for 10 mins or less every 2 to 3 hours. If i try to feed earlier or more, she does not open her mouth. Her birth weight was 3kgs and her weight as of 8 weeks is 4.8kgs. She pees around 13 times if feeding less, or around 17 times if she feeds more. Is this normal??

1 Answer
profile image of Dr GhouseDr GhouseGuardian of 3 children4 years ago

A. since your baby is gaining weight appropriately and even passing urine also more than adequately there is no need to worry about the feeding schedule of the baby probably baby is normal
